Understanding Roth IRA Basics
A Roth IRA is a retirement savings account that allows your contributions to grow tax-free. Unlike traditional IRAs, contributions to a Roth IRA are made with after-tax dollars, meaning you won’t pay taxes on qualified withdrawals in retirement. This makes it an attractive option for freelancers who expect their income to grow over time.

Integrating Roth IRA Contributions into Your Budget
To effectively include Roth IRA contributions in your freelance budget, start by assessing your income and expenses. Determine how much you can comfortably allocate each month toward retirement savings without sacrificing essential expenses.
Step-by-Step Budgeting Tips
- Set a monthly contribution goal based on your income and retirement plans.
- Prioritize your contributions as a non-negotiable expense, just like rent or utilities.
- Automate deposits into your Roth IRA to ensure consistency.
- Adjust contributions during months with higher or lower income.
Additional Tips for Freelancers
Freelancers often face variable income, making it important to stay flexible. Consider the following tips:
- Build an emergency fund to cover unexpected expenses, freeing up income for retirement contributions.
- Review your budget regularly to accommodate changes in income or expenses.
